If button specific styling is needed, the following css class names can be used for overrides or. The first line, adds jquery ui theme in our case uilightness via css. For example, you could easily tweak the corner radius for all buttons to be different than the rest of the ui components or change the path for the icon sprite to use a custom set. The first line, adds jquery ui theme in our case ui lightness via css. To get a bit more control over the look and feel, you may choose to start with the default theme smoothness or a themerollergenerated theme and then adjust the jqueryui. Theming jquery ui includes a robust css framework designed for building custom jquery widgets. Jqueryui autocomplete auto completion is a mechanism frequently used in modern websites to provide the user with a list of suggestions for the beginning of the word, which heshe has. For example, you could easily tweak the corner radius for all buttons to be different than. W3schools is optimized for learning, testing, and training. This section looks at example code that uses some common widgets to build an example application. There are three general approaches to theming jquery ui plugins. The framework includes classes that cover a wide array of common user interface needs, and can be manipulated using jquery ui themeroller. Each demo allows you to view source code, change themes, and the url can always be bookmarked.
As you work, the ui components to the right will update to reflect your design and. Changing themes on the client the following example demonstrates a possible way to switch the kendo ui themes on the client by replacing the css stylesheets. To have your table styles integrate with jquery uis themeroller styles, simply include the datatables css and js integration files for jquery ui, as shown in this. If you have heavily modified the css stylesheet of a default themeroller theme or have created a custom css theme from scratch, then it is necessary to perform manual updates for future jquery ui widgets and plugins. The jquery ui selectable plugin allows for elements to be selected by dragging a box sometimes called a lasso with the mouse over the elements. Our jquery ui tutorial for beginners with examples will help you learn jquery ui fast for this is a cool step by step guide.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ore.
To have your table styles integrate with jquery uis themeroller styles, simply include the datatables css and js integration files for jquery ui, as shown in this example. Check out the themeroller website, which allows you to test existing themes from the jquery ui platform, customize existing themes, or create custom themes. Also, you can find some interesting themes in gallery section. Because this approach is not related to the functionality of the kendo ui suite, it does not require you to apply kendo ui api calls. Is there an easy way to change the theme of the jquery ui by replacing certain files. Using jquery ui themeroller jquery learning center. The a swatch is a neutral, gray swatch, and the b swatch has a darker color scheme designed to contrast with the a swatch. For example, building a bootstrap theme for jquery ui is now a lot easier. Add jquery ui theme via css external link, put it inside. You can use b to draw special attention to elements in a user interface styled with a, and vice versa. This example contains a slider widget, a button that opens a dialog box.
Scroll vertical with jquery ui themeroller this example is an extension of the vertical scrolling example, showing datatables ability to be themed by jquery ui s themeroller. The default jquery mobile theme provides two swatches. Jqueryui button jqueryui provides button method to transform the html elements like buttons, inputs and anchors into themeable buttons, with automatic management of mouse m. It can display information, gives you choices or even contain an html form. I love modals, or a modal window or modal dialog, it is a child window that pops up in your application that requires a user interaction. Sets a new background swatch for the page widgets container usually the body. Themeroller allows you to design custom jquery ui themes for tight integration in your projects. Themeroller is a web app that offers a fun and intuitive interface for designing and downloading custom themes for jquery ui.
As you work, the ui components to the right will update to reflect your design and you can download your theme whenever you like. Play with the demos, view the source, build a theme, read the api documentation and start using jquery ui today. The spinner, or number stepper widget, is perfect for handling all kinds of numeric input. If you dont want these themes, there is a website where you can find a lot of custom jquery ui themes. Datatables example scroll vertical with jquery ui themeroller. Note also that because jquery doesnt provide table styles like some other css frameworks, the css integration file does add this styling information. The default color scheme of accordion jquery ui plugin is the grayish type. How to create jquery tabs by ui plugin with 5 examples. To have your table styles integrate with jquery ui s themeroller styles, simply include the datatables css and js integration files for jquery ui, as shown in this example. Browse other questions tagged jquery jqueryui jqueryuidatepicker or ask your own question. Browse other questions tagged jquery jquery ui jquery ui datepicker or ask your own question.
The jquery ui is now the industry standard for theme implementation. These items are styled with the bar swatch b by default blue in the default theme but you can specify a theme for dividers by adding the datadivider theme attribute to the list element ul or ol and specifying a theme swatch letter. A massive guide to custom theming jquery ui widgets. The jquery ui platform consists of two subframeworks. For this example, we have changed the default colors by using inline css. With the theme roller, there are constant trade offs, so you can blame a lot of the inconsistencies on that. It allows users to type a value directly, or modify an existing value by spinning with the keyboard, mouse or scrollwheel. These items are styled with the bar swatch b by default blue in the default theme but you can specify a theme for dividers by adding the datadividertheme attribute to the list element ul or ol and specifying a theme swatch letter. Themeroller tool and can be referenced at ajaxlibsjqueryui1. The checkboxradio widget uses the jquery ui css framework to style its look and feel. Now, let us look at a few examples of using jquery tab ui plugin. In addition, official support for ie8, ie9, and ie10 have been removed, but the workarounds. It seems like i have to keep downloading the entire jquery ui every time i want to change the theme. However, for your web projects you would want to match it to rest of the sites theme.
Although jquery ui isnt a css framework in the same sense as bootstrap or foundation it does provide a common styling framework for its widgets through its themeroller component. Jqueryui menu a menu widget usually consists of a main menu bar with pop up menus. It takes advantage of css3 properties to add rounded corners, box and text shadow and gradients instead of images, allowing the theme file to be very lightweight and reducing server requests. A jquery plugin that sets a div or span to allow the user to select a css theme to apply to your site. The theming system used in jquery mobile is similar to the themeroller system in jquery ui with a few important improvements. To customize the look of your application, use the data theme attribute, and assign the attribute with a letter. These examples show different expressions of kendo ui templates which can be represented as a basic template, script elements, encoding html and js code inside the template definition. Applies the theme border radius if set to true by adding the class ui cornerall to the textinput widgets outermost element. Getting started with jquery ui jquery learning center. Second line, adds the jquery library, as jquery ui is built on top of jquery library. The easiest way to build a theme is to use themeroller to generate and download a theme. To customize the look of your application, use the datatheme attribute, and assign the attribute with a letter. In the following example, we have created simple tabs by using tab ui plugin in jquery.
The button widget uses the jquery ui css framework to style its look and feel. Scroll vertical with jquery ui themeroller this example is an extension of the vertical scrolling example, showing datatables ability to be themed by jquery uis themeroller. If checkboxradio specific styling is needed, the following css class names can be used for overrides or as keys for the classes option. List items can be turned into dividers to organize and group the list items. Examples might be simplified to improve reading and basic understanding. In addition, official support for ie8, ie9, and ie10 have been removed, but the workarounds are still in place and will be removed in 1. To create a custom theme, select the roll your own tab and tweak the settings. It takes advantage of css3 properties to add rounded corners, box and text shadow and gradients instead of images, allowing the theme file to be very lightweight and reducing server requests themes include multiple color swatches each.
This is done by adding the datarolelistdivider to any list item. Jun 28, 2017 our jquery ui tutorial for beginners with examples will help you learn jquery ui fast for this is a cool step by step guide. Elements can also be selected via click or drag while holding the ctrlmeta key, allowing for multiple noncontiguous selections. Download jquery ui to test and follow along with this article and the examples it provides themeroller.
1492 533 1082 278 1290 786 695 324 329 301 1380 377 350 1437 1004 915 436 885 1151 1531 1252 77 542 1150 253 1593 1224 1566 1284 50 1497 1221 1562 737 81 326 1357 205 1452 1115 395 523 999 2 912 412 901